发布网友 发布时间:2023-09-24 05:42
共1个回答
热心网友 时间:2023-09-24 14:38
数据建模是数据管理中非常重要的一环,它可以帮助我们理解数据之间的关系,从而更好地管理和利用数据。而数据建模工具则是帮助我们进行数据建模的重要工具。本文将介绍几款常用的数据建模工具,以及它们的操作步骤和优缺点。
1.ERwinDataModeler
ERwinDataModeler是一款功能强大的数据建模工具,它可以帮助用户快速创建和管理复杂的数据模型。它支持多种数据库平台,包括Oracle、SQLServer、MySQL等。使用ERwinDataModeler进行数据建模的步骤如下:
1)创建数据模型:在ERwinDataModeler中,用户可以通过拖拽和放置来创建实体、属性和关系等元素,从而构建数据模型。
2)定义实体和属性:在创建实体和属性时,用户需要定义它们的名称、数据类型、长度等属性。
3)定义关系:在定义关系时,用户需要指定关系类型、关系名称、关系的起点和终点等属性。
4)生成脚本:完成数据模型的设计后,用户可以生成相应的数据库脚本,从而在数据库中创建相应的表和关系。
优点:ERwinDataModeler具有丰富的功能和灵活的界面,可以帮助用户快速创建和管理复杂的数据模型。
缺点:ERwinDataModeler的价格比较高,对于小型企业和个人用户来说可能不太适合。
2.MySQLWorkbench
MySQLWorkbench是一款免费的数据建模工具,它可以帮助用户进行数据库设计、管理和维护等工作。使用MySQLWorkbench进行数据建模的步骤如下:
1)创建数据模型:在MySQLWorkbench中,用户可以通过拖拽和放置来创建实体、属性和关系等元素,从而构建数据模型。
2)定义实体和属性:在创建实体和属性时,用户需要定义它们的名称、数据类型、长度等属性。
3)定义关系:在定义关系时,用户需要指定关系类型、关系名称、关系的起点和终点等属性。
4)生成脚本:完成数据模型的设计后,用户可以生成相应的数据库脚本,从而在数据库中创建相应的表和关系。
优点:MySQLWorkbench是一款免费的数据建模工具,功能比较全面,适合小型企业和个人用户使用。
缺点:MySQLWorkbench的界面相对较为简单,可能不太适合进行复杂的数据建模工作。
3.PowerDesigner
PowerDesigner是一款功能强大的数据建模工具,它可以帮助用户进行数据建模、数据分析和数据设计等工作。使用PowerDesigner进行数据建模的步骤如下:
1)创建数据模型:在PowerDesigner中,用户可以通过拖拽和放置来创建实体、属性和关系等元素,从而构建数据模型。
2)定义实体和属性:在创建实体和属性时,用户需要定义它们的名称、数据类型、长度等属性。
3)定义关系:在定义关系时,用户需要指定关系类型、关系名称、关系的起点和终点等属性。
4)生成脚本:完成数据模型的设计后,用户可以生成相应的数据库脚本,从而在数据库中创建相应的表和关系。
优点:PowerDesigner具有丰富的功能和灵活的界面,可以帮助用户快速创建和管理复杂的数据模型。
缺点:PowerDesigner的价格比较高,对于小型企业和个人用户来说可能不太适合。